The Best Self Defense Tips For Seniors-the Top Five

This is no news to you I am sure-the senior population is the fastest growing segment of our society

. Opportunists, scam artists, burglars, robbers and petty crooks salivate over the 'easy pickins' seniors present at home, on the road and just everyday activities-especially shopping.

They see seniors as easy 'targets of opportunity' especially older women. Knowing that is a little edge because armed with that knowledge you can prepare and make yourself less vulnerable.

How?

1.Learn some basic Self Defense Techniques-There are several self defense DVD's that don't require any special athletic ability and are not strenuous. Get a group and learn together and make it a social thing. The 8 basic moves of Jeet Kune Do (JKD) will get you out of 95 % of all street confrontations and is a great place to start.


2.Don't be a target-Walk with a sense of Confidence. Believe it or not the bad guys look for anyone who walks with their head down and is distracted-like talking on a cell phone.

3.Walk in pairs-Two or more people walking together are much less likely to be victims of an attack so go everywhere with a buddie. Even if it is just leaving a grocery store at night ask someone to go with you to your car.

4.Daytime activities. Try to do all of your chores and running around in the daytime. The facts support the notion that the bad guys don't like light and do most of their work at night under cover of darkness.

5.Carry-Carry some self defense products. The bad guys don't like noise so a personal alarm is the number one recommendation. They are easy to use, inexpensive and if you get in trouble will draw attention from hundreds of yards away. Pepper sprays are next followed by stun guns. Carry all three for best protection.

A well rounded self defense strategy should feature a basic self defense techniques course, a good pepper spray and stun device. These self defense products can be your best friends in a time of need. What are you waiting for?

Remember too that all self defense products are meant to give you time to get away from a dangerous situation-nothing more.

If you feel threatened by an assailant point a charging stun gun at him and hold it up for the bad guys to see the flying current and hear the sounds. From a distance the crackling noise alone and blue sparks that stun guns give off when activated may be enough to keep attackers at bay.

If you are in the market for a self defense product look for quality, effectiveness, and a biggie-LEGALITY. Stun guns are not legal in some states. Some states have restrictions on pepper sprays. Check with your local police department first before you get one.
